CNN Reporter Appalled by Obama/Hitler Comparison, Flashback: Linking Bush/Hitler, Eh...Not So Much

"In (her segment) (Susan Roesgen) sought out another TEA Party participant who had a mocked-up sign in which President Barack Obama is melded with Adolf Hitler.  She immediately began arguing with this gentleman as well; amongst the things she angrily said were "Why be so hard on the President of the United States with such an offensive message?" and "Do you realize how offensive that is?"

While I agree with her that it is over the line to like Obama with Hitler, that isn't the point of this post. Newsbusters has dug up an old video of her covering a anti-Bush protest in New Orleans where someone made a float with W's head with devil horns and a Hitler mustache, and all she could say about it was this:

"City officials aren’t the only ones wondering when federal money will materialize. Catholic school girls marched on Jackson Square. They and their teachers say more money is needed to fix the levees, and they hoped the President would stop by after his meeting with business leaders. But while a look-alike showed up with a wad of cash, Mr. Bush did not."

This "look-alike" was the previously mentioned Bush head. Where was her outrage then? There was a stark difference in her demeanor between her confronting the "tea" protestor and her commenting on the Bush float.
